Financial Times:
Sources: UK's NHS has already begun developing a second contact tracing app, using Google and Apple's contact tracing APIs  —  NHS team that built first app is told to build another on Apple-Google system  —  The NHS has already begun building a second smartphone app to trace the spread of the coronavirus …
Wired:
States like NY, CA, MA, and cities like Baltimore and SF are skeptical about tech-based contact tracing, instead hiring thousands for manual contact tracing  —  Silicon Valley companies have proposed automating the arduous task of identifying people potentially exposed to Covid-19.  They're finding few takers.

Dina Bass / Bloomberg:
Dropbox reports first quarterly profit since IPO, with Q1 net income of $39.3M and sales up 18% YoY to $455M; paying customers rose to 14.6M from 13.2M in 2019  —  Dropbox Inc. reported its first-ever net income, in a quarter when demand for cloud software was bolstered by a shift to working from home.

Ari Levy / CNBC:
Zoom is acquiring Keybase, a 25-person startup, to add end-to-end encryption to video calls, the first acquisition in the company's nine-year history  —  - Zoom is acquiring Keybase, a 25-person start-up in New York, to add end-to-end encryption to video calls.
